Hello,
we have a strange problem with our Cisco ISR4431/K9 router. There is a VM behind it, which is trying to connect a server in Internet.
We have a NAT configuration on the router which allows all other clients to connect to Internet resources without any problem.
Only for this server in Internet we have connectivity issues. In Wireshark capture we see that the request is send to the server from the outer interface of the router, then we see a response from server which says that "TCP Port numbers reused" and immediately after that router sends TCP RST signal to server.
What can be the problem and how to fix it?
